Graboski gets new Global post
By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, April 18, 2004
MOORESVILLE, N.C. — MOORESVILLE, N.C.— Randy Graboski has joined solid-wood case goods importer Global Furniture in the new position of vice president of sales. He reports to Jack DeBonis, president and CEO.
Graboski has responsibility for Global's sales organization as well as development of national accounts.
He brings over 30 years experience, most recently at Powell, where he was a regional sales manager, and previously at Stoneville.
Earlier, he worked in the Levitz retail organization for 27 years as a store manager, merchandise manager and Northeast region vice president.
"Randy has a great knowledge of retail and is well respected throughout the trade. We fully expect him to excel in his new post," said DeBonis.
Global specializes in solid wood case goods and leather upholstery marketed under the Heirloom Traditions brand.
Its High Point market showroom is at 156 South Main St.
